Description

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following (other duties may be assigned).

  • Analyze and forecast realtime patterns for multiple agent skills associated with varying interaction types to drive efficiency and productivity.
  • Assist in creating staffing plans and employee schedules to meet forecasted demand.
  • Coordinate the sensible implementation of staff scheduling requests including swaps, PTO approval, leaves of absence, etc.; working to maintain a balance between employee needs and volume demands.
  • Work directly with WFM Supervisor, WFM Analyst(s), WFM Specialist(s).
  • Perform daily, weekly, and monthly maintenance tasks in WFM system.
  • Assist in making necessary staffing, WFM system, and phone system adjustments to meet daily, weekly, and monthly contact center goals.
  • Responsible for maintaining a positive work environment by interacting with all employees in a respectful, professional manner.
  • Adhere to expense expectations as defined by Senior Management
  • Enforce and abide by all company policies and procedures as listed in the Employee Handbook and/or established by or directed by management.
